"Monterrey was founded in 1596 by Diego de Montemayor along with twelve other companions and their families. Founded as a Spanish settlement in 1596, Monterrey grew slowly, owing to Indian resistance, periodic floods, and a lack of mineral wealth. Don Israel Cavazos Garza and Isabel Ortega Ridaura mention in their book, HistoriaBreve Nuevo Leon, a list of the early settlers of Monterrey and thus I consider the people listed there as the founding families.
